About the new Honda ZR-V partial improvement
The partial improvement includes the adoption of a new exterior paint, which was first applied to the “CIVIC RS” and “FREED.” The clear material used in the paint has been changed from the conventional acrylic melamine material to a more functional material. This increases the glossiness of the body and improves durability by more than 1.5 times compared to the previous model.
Honda New ZR-V Partial Improvement Price
Prices have increased by 75,900 yen for all grades due to rising raw material prices.

How many units have the new Honda ZR-V sold?
Sales volume in 2024
Sales in the first half of 2024 are expected to exceed those in 2023.
| year and month | Sales volume |
|---|---|
| January 2024 | 3,741 units |
| February 2024 | 2,609 units |
| March 2024 | 4,925 units |
| April 2024 | 3,179 units |
| May 2024 | 3,185 units |
| June 2024 | 4,470 units |
| July 2024 | 4,664 units |
| August 2024 | 3,277 units |
| September 2024 | 3,381 units |
| October 2024 | 2,424 units |
| November 2024 | 2,397 units |
| December 2024 | 2,037 units |
| total | 41,513 units |
Honda ZR-V registration numbers Source: Japan Automobile Dealers Association
The monthly sales target announced in April 2023 was 1,200 units. In 2024, Honda is expected to produce an average of approximately 3,800 units, exceeding the target. In other words, production and orders are exceeding the planned number, and Honda is working hard.

Honda’s new “ZR-V” exterior
The exterior features flowing proportions characterized by voluminous, smooth surfaces from front to rear. The front features a vertical grille that is continuous with the surrounding shape, and long, sharp headlights, giving it a refined yet dignified presence. The rear emphasizes the wide tread by giving volume to the lower part of the body and tapering smoothly upwards. The body size is easy to handle, providing ample interior space and practicality for enjoying a variety of activities, including weekend leisure activities, while also allowing for nimble driving around town. The body measures 4,580mm in length, 1,800mm in width, 1,630mm in height, and a wheelbase of 2,735mm.

Honda’s new “ZR-V” engine
The hybrid model is the first SUV to feature the newly developed 2.0L direct injection engine and two-motor electric CVT from the Civic e:HEV. A gasoline model with a 1.5L turbo engine and CVT is also available, offering a highly responsive and nimble ride.
Both the hybrid and gasoline models are available with Real Time AWD. It offers excellent cornering and hill-climbing performance on snow, allowing for safe driving on snow.

The interior is equipped with an ” Auto Brake Hold ” function, which keeps the vehicle stationary even when the driver’s foot is taken off the brake pedal and releases the brake when the driver steps on the accelerator, making it useful in traffic jams . It also features a ” Parking Brake System .” The Honda CONNECT , an in-vehicle communication module equipped with next-generation connected technology, offers the ” Honda Total Care Premium” connected service, providing a safer and more comfortable driving experience . The center display features a 9-inch Honda CONNECT Honda Display . It is compatible with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to . The Honda CONNECT, an in-vehicle communication module exclusive to Honda vehicles, is also included. “Honda Total Care Premium” is available. Remote operation via smartphone is possible, and the car itself connects to an emergency support center in the event of an accident or other emergency, enabling quick and accurate troubleshooting. The car also comes with an “Automatic Map Update Service.” The car is equipped with the Honda Digital Key and Honda App Center , which allow your smartphone to function as a key , and in-car Wi-Fi, which allows you to purchase data capacity in the car and connect to the Internet for enjoyment.

Honda’s new “ZR-V” equipped with Honda SENSING
The advanced safety driving support system ” Honda SENSING ” newly adopts a ” Front Wide View Camera ” high-speed image processing chip, and by combining it with a total of eight sonar sensors installed in the front and rear of the vehicle, a “Near Collision Mitigation Brake” has been added and is now standard equipment on all vehicles. Four sensors are placed in the rear bumper and detect obstacles behind the vehicle and notify the driver with sound and display.
